What happens when the thing you've worked your whole life for is suddenly taken away? In this episode, James Renshaw and Parker Henry share honest stories about setbacks, injuries, disappointment, and how God used those moments to reshape their identity and purpose. Parker opens up about the heartbreak of falling short at the state wrestling tournament and how that experience inspired him to pursue sports psychology. James shares how two traumatic skull injuries, the loss of a classmate, and learning to put Christ above basketball transformed his life and eventually led him into student ministry. Whether you're an athlete, coach, student, or parent, this conversation is a reminder that your identity is found in Christ—not in wins, losses, or achievements.
